Image of architecture

This piece of architecture is called the Arch of Constantine. It is located in Italy, Rome, next to the Colosseum. This piece of work was constructed as a celebration for Constantine's victory over Maxentius. Interestingly, the Romans liked their architecture to have an obvious entrance, hence there is the use of a large arch, which is accompanied by smaller arches on both sides.
